The Secret to Superhuman Strength

In the Secret to Superhuman Strength, the author narrates the history of her life (and the world around her) through her athletic interests. As a young girl in the 1960s, there were limited athletic opportunities. However, there was the appeal of the comic book adds for superhuman strength. Alas, these did not pan out. However, running did prove to provide a great experience. The book continues passing through many fitness fads while also tying together the transcendentalists (especially Margaret Fuller) and the beat generation (especially Kerouac). The key historical events often happen in the background (with an occasional asterisk for "obsolete" items such as newspapers). She adopts skiing early with her family. She later moves to intense biking after being influenced by a partner. Karate and Yoga also play significant roles in her life.
